Веб-разработка — это одно из самых востребованных направлений в IT-сфере. И чтобы успешно вести проекты в данной сфере, требуется использовать профессиональные программы для веб-разработки. Эти инструменты помогут в кратчайшие сроки создавать качественные веб-сайты, работать с базами данных и вести проекты в команде.
Одной из таких программ является Adobe Dreamweaver. Это интегрированная среда разработки, которая позволяет создавать сайты на различных языках программирования. Dreamweaver предлагает широкие возможности для работы с кодом, позволяет визуально редактировать и тестировать дизайн веб-сайта. Также программа обладает функцией предпросмотра, которая позволяет видеть изменения на сайте в режиме реального времени.
Еще одной популярной программой для веб-разработки является Sublime Text. Она отличается высокой скоростью работы и множеством полезных функций. Sublime Text предоставляет богатый выбор плагинов, которые значительно упрощают разработку веб-сайтов. Программа поддерживает различные языки программирования, обладает функцией автозавершения кода и позволяет просматривать несколько файлов одновременно в разных вкладках.
Интегрированные среды разработки (IDE)
Существует множество IDE, специализированных на различных языках программирования и фреймворках. Некоторые из самых популярных IDE для веб-разработки:
1. Visual Studio Code: Это бесплатная и надежная IDE, разработанная Microsoft. Она поддерживает большое количество языков программирования и предоставляет множество расширений для улучшения процесса разработки.
2. JetBrains WebStorm: Это платная IDE, специализированная на веб-разработке. Она предлагает множество инструментов для работы с HTML, CSS, JavaScript и другими технологиями веб-разработки.
3. Atom: Это бесплатная и кросс-платформенная IDE, созданная командой GitHub. Она имеет дружественный интерфейс, а также множество плагинов и тем для настройки внешнего вида и функционала.
4. Sublime Text: Это легковесная и мощная IDE с большим количеством функций. Она позволяет быстро редактировать и организовывать код, а также поддерживает множество плагинов.
5. Eclipse: Это бесплатная и мощная IDE, изначально разработанная для языка Java, но поддерживающая также различные другие языки программирования. Она предоставляет широкий набор инструментов для разработки и отладки веб-приложений.
Выбор IDE зависит от индивидуальных предпочтений и требований разработчика. Каждая IDE имеет свои особенности и преимущества, поэтому важно определить, какая из них наиболее подходит для конкретной задачи.
Visual Studio Code
Visual Studio Code обладает множеством полезных функций, которые делают его идеальным инструментом для разработки веб-приложений. Некоторые из них включают:
Функция | Описание |
---|---|
Подсветка синтаксиса | Подсвечивает различные элементы кода, что облегчает его чтение и написание. |
Автодополнение кода | Предлагает автоматические варианты кода, основываясь на уже написанном коде и контексте. |
Отладка | Позволяет легко отлаживать код, устанавливать точки останова и просматривать значения переменных. |
Интеграция с Git | Позволяет управлять репозиториями Git, делать коммиты, ветвиться и сливаться с легкостью. |
Расширяемость | Visual Studio Code может быть расширен с помощью различных плагинов и расширений, что позволяет настроить его под нужды разработчика. |
Visual Studio Code также имеет простой и интуитивно понятный интерфейс, что делает его доступным даже для новичков. Кроме того, он является платформонезависимым и может быть установлен на операционные системы Windows, macOS и Linux.
В целом, Visual Studio Code — это мощный и удобный инструмент для веб-разработки, который предлагает множество функций и возможностей. Он позволяет разработчикам быть более продуктивными и создавать качественный веб-код с минимальными усилиями.
PhpStorm
Основные преимущества PhpStorm включают в себя:
- Поддержка всех основных функций языка PHP, включая синтаксическую подсветку, автодополнение кода и проверку на ошибки.
- Интеграция с популярными фреймворками, такими как Laravel, Symfony и Yii, что позволяет упростить разработку и повысить производительность.
- Возможность интеграции с системами контроля версий, такими как Git, что обеспечивает командную работу над проектами и отслеживание изменений.
- Встроенный отладчик, который позволяет искать и исправлять ошибки в коде, что значительно упрощает процесс отладки.
- Инструменты для улучшения производительности, такие как автоматическое форматирование кода и оптимизация проекта.
- Широкие возможности для настройки среды разработки, включая выбор темы, настройку горячих клавиш и установку плагинов.
В целом, PhpStorm является мощным инструментом для разработки веб-приложений на языке PHP, который облегчает процесс написания и поддержки кода, увеличивая производительность и качество работ.
WebStorm
WebStorm предлагает широкий набор инструментов и функций, которые упрощают и ускоряют процесс разработки веб-приложений. В этой IDE доступны инструменты для работы с HTML, CSS, JavaScript, TypeScript, а также с такими технологиями, как Angular, React, Vue.js и многими другими.
Одним из главных преимуществ WebStorm является его интеллектуальный код-редактор. Он предлагает автодополнение, подсветку синтаксиса, проверку ошибок, рефакторинг кода и многое другое. Это помогает программисту писать код более эффективно и избегать ошибок.
WebStorm также имеет встроенные инструменты для отладки кода и профайлинга производительности, что позволяет находить и исправлять ошибки более быстро. IDE легко интегрируется с различными системами контроля версий, такими как Git, Mercurial и SVN, что облегчает работу в команде.
В целом, WebStorm – это отличный инструмент для веб-разработки, который позволяет сократить время на разработку и повысить производительность команды. Он является платным продуктом, но его цена оправдывается его функциональностью и качеством.
Текстовые редакторы с поддержкой веб-разработки
Существует множество текстовых редакторов с поддержкой веб-разработки, каждый из которых имеет свои особенности и удобства. Ниже приведен список некоторых из наиболее популярных текстовых редакторов для веб-разработки:
- Visual Studio Code — бесплатный и мощный редактор кода, разработанный Microsoft. Он предлагает широкий набор функций, интеграцию с различными плагинами и инструментами, а также поддержку многих языков программирования.
- Sublime Text — еще один популярный текстовый редактор с большим количеством функций и возможностей настройки. Он обладает быстрым и производительным движком, а также поддерживает множество плагинов.
- Atom — бесплатный редактор кода, созданный GitHub. Он предоставляет возможность настройки интерфейса и позволяет использовать множество плагинов для расширения его функциональности.
- Brackets — текстовый редактор, специально созданный для веб-разработки. Он предлагает функции, которые помогают разрабатывать и отлаживать код, такие как предварительный просмотр в реальном времени и подсветка синтаксиса.
Каждый из этих текстовых редакторов имеет свои плюсы и минусы, и выбор зависит от ваших предпочтений и потребностей. Важно помнить, что хороший текстовый редактор с поддержкой веб-разработки может существенно упростить и ускорить процесс разработки веб-проектов.
Sublime Text
Основные преимущества:
1. | Простой и интуитивно понятный интерфейс, облегчающий работу с кодом. |
2. | Подсветка синтаксиса для большинства языков программирования, что помогает разработчику быстро находить ошибки. |
3. | Многоязычная поддержка, что позволяет работать с разными языками программирования и файловыми форматами. |
4. | Автоматическое завершение кода и быстрые команды, упрощающие процесс написания кода. |
5. | Возможность установки расширений и плагинов, расширяющих функциональность редактора. |
6. | Высокая производительность, способность обрабатывать большие объемы данных в реальном времени. |
Sublime Text также поддерживает использование тем и настраиваемых схем цветов, что позволяет настроить редактор в соответствии с предпочтениями пользователя. Благодаря широкому функционалу и гибким настройкам, Sublime Text стал одним из самых популярных выборов среди веб-разработчиков.
Atom
Atom поддерживает множество языков программирования, благодаря чему он становится удобным инструментом для разработчиков со множеством проектов на разных языках.
Основная особенность Atom — его гибкость. Он позволяет пользователям настраивать интерфейс, добавлять плагины и расширения, чтобы адаптировать редактор под свои потребности и предпочтения.
Atom имеет интуитивно понятный и легкий в использовании интерфейс. Он предлагает цельную среду разработки с удобным редактированием текста, автодополнением, подсветкой синтаксиса и горячими клавишами.
Один из главных плюсов Atom состоит в его расширяемости. Редактор имеет широкую коллекцию плагинов и тем, разработанных сообществом, которые позволяют пользователям настраивать свое рабочее окружение и повышать эффективность своей работы.
- Плагины, такие как Emmet, позволяют быстро писать HTML и CSS код, сокращая время и усилия.
- Git integration позволяет вести контроль версий и совместную работу с другими разработчиками.
- Мощный поиск и замена позволяют быстро находить и изменять текст в больших проектах.
Atom является популярным выбором для веб-разработчиков благодаря своей гибкости, удобству использования и широкому выбору плагинов. Этот редактор поможет повысить эффективность работы и сделает процесс разработки более приятным.
Notepad++
Преимущества использования Notepad++ в веб-разработке:
1. Легкий и быстрый | Notepad++ является легким и быстрым редактором, который позволяет открыть и редактировать файлы без задержек. |
2. Подсветка синтаксиса | Редактор поддерживает подсветку синтаксиса для различных языков программирования, что помогает веб-разработчикам лучше ориентироваться в коде. |
3. Многофункциональность | Notepad++ предлагает много полезных функций, таких как поиск и замена, автодополнение кода, работа с макросами и другие, что упрощает и ускоряет процесс разработки. |
4. Плагины | Редактор поддерживает плагины, которые позволяют расширить его возможности и добавить новые функции. |
5. Переносимость | Notepad++ можно установить на различные операционные системы, что делает его удобным для использования на разных компьютерах. |
В целом, Notepad++ — это мощный и удобный инструмент для веб-разработки, который поможет вам улучшить процесс написания кода и повысить производительность.
Веб-браузеры с инструментами разработчика
Наиболее популярные веб-браузеры с инструментами разработчика:
Название | Описание |
---|---|
Google Chrome | Google Chrome является одним из самых популярных браузеров среди разработчиков. Он предлагает широкий набор инструментов разработчика, включая консоль, инспектор элементов, сетевую панель и другие полезные функции. |
Mozilla Firefox | Mozilla Firefox также предлагает мощные инструменты разработчика. Он включает инструменты для отладки JavaScript, анализа сетевого трафика и редактирования кода CSS и HTML. Firefox также имеет много расширений, которые могут расширить возможности разработчика. |
Microsoft Edge | Microsoft Edge — это браузер, разработанный компанией Microsoft. Он имеет инструменты разработчика, которые позволяют анализировать и редактировать код веб-страниц, отлавливать ошибки и профилировать производительность приложений. |
Safari | Safari — это веб-браузер, разработанный компанией Apple. Он также предлагает инструменты разработчика, включая инспектор элементов и консоль ошибок, которые помогают разработчикам отлаживать веб-сайты на устройствах Apple. |
Выбор веб-браузера с инструментами разработчика зависит от ваших предпочтений и потребностей. Каждый из перечисленных браузеров предлагает свои особенности и функциональность, поэтому рекомендуется попробовать несколько из них и выбрать наиболее подходящий для ваших задач.